What would happen to the dandelion siphonophore population if the tube anemone population increased?​
irina1246 [14]
This dandelion siphonophore is the first we observed on this expedition. Found at approximately 2,530 meters (8,300 feet) depth, we were able to see the feeding tentacles extended around the animal like a spider web as well as the pulsating nectophores, found just below and around the “float,” which helped to keep the central body suspended.

On the rare occasions we encounter these invertebrates, they appear from a distance as a pulsating, faintly glowing, orange-yellow ball that seems to hover just above the bottom

Which one of NASA's "great observatories" was the first to be launched and is still gathering information on earth and its locat
blagie [28]

With the capabilities the Space Shuttle provides, scientist now have the means for deploying these observatories from the Shuttle's cargo bay directly into orbit. NASA's Hubble Space Telescope, the first of the great observatories, was deployed from the Space Shuttle Discovery into Earth orbit in April 1990.
